Miles vs. LSUHSC

Miles ranked #-1 and LSUHSC ranked #-1 in national university ranking. The following statements compare Miles College and Louisiana State University Health Sciences Center-New Orleans with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• LSUHSC's tuition ($18,851) is more expensive than Miles ($12,714).
  • LSUHSC's students to faculty ratio (3 to 1) is lower than Miles (12 to 1).
  • LSUHSC (2,683 students) is larger than Miles (1,151 students) with more enrolled students.
  • Miles ($9,287) has higher amount of financial aid than LSUHSC ($6,701).
  • Both schools have same graduation rate of 26%.
